What Qualifies as a Plumbing Emergency?

Identifying Urgent Plumbing Issues

Not every plumbing problem is an emergency. Understanding what qualifies as an urgent issue is crucial. Common emergencies include major leaks, burst pipes, overflowing toilets, and sewer backups. These problems can severely affect your property and health, demanding immediate attention. Distinguishing between what can wait and what requires urgent care is key to managing plumbing situations effectively.

Best Practices for Homeowners During an Emergency

When a plumbing emergency occurs, quick action is essential. Homeowners should know how to turn off the main water supply to prevent further damage. Keeping contact information for emergency plumbers handy can save precious time. Additionally, documenting the issue with photos can be helpful for insurance claims and repair discussions.

How to Distinguish Between Urgent and Non-Urgent Issues

Learning to differentiate between urgent and non-urgent plumbing issues can help homeowners avoid unnecessary stress. Problems such as minor leaks or slow drains can often wait for normal working hours, while significant issues like a broken sump pump or severe water leaks should be addressed immediately. This knowledge can help prioritize responses to plumbing situations effectively.
